Pair of Late 18th Century French Painted Hand Carved Boiserie Panels
Located in Fayetteville, AR
Standing at 51.5 inches in height, this pair of tall late eighteenth century painted panels were originally part of the boiserie in a French chateau. The panels are detailed with hunting motifs including a hunting dog holding a game bird in its mouth as well as fruits and leaves. The panel is painted in pale green with gold detailing around its beveled edge. These narrow panels would be ideal to hang as three dimensional art...
